# ce8e8087 25-Oct-2019 Kaike Wan <kaike.wan@intel.com>

IB/hfi1: TID RDMA WRITE should not return IB_WC_RNR_RETRY_EXC_ERR

Normal RDMA WRITE request never returns IB_WC_RNR_RETRY_EXC_ERR to ULPs
because it does not need post receive buffer on the responder side.
Consequently, as an enhancement to normal RDMA WRITE request inside the
hfi1 driver, TID RDMA WRITE request should not return such an error status
to ULPs, although it does receive RNR NAKs from the responder when TID
resources are not available. This behavior is violated when
qp->s_rnr_retry_cnt is set in current hfi1 implementation.

This patch enforces these semantics by avoiding any reaction to the updates
of the RNR QP attributes.

# 5136bfea 28-Jun-2019 Kamenee Arumugam <kamenee.arumugam@intel.com>

IB/{hfi1, qib, rdmavt}: Put qp in error state when cq is full

When a completion queue is full, the associated queue pairs are not put
into the error state. According to the IBTA specification, this is a
violation.

Quote from IBTA spec:
C9-218: A Requester Class F error occurs when the CQ is inaccessible or
full and an attempt is made to complete a WQE. The Affected QP shall be
moved to the error state and affiliated asynchronous errors generated as
described in 11.6.3.1 Affiliated Asynchronous Events on page 678. The
current WQE and any subsequent WQEs are left in an unknown state.

C11-37: The CI shall generate a CQ Error when a CQ overrun is
detected. This condition will result in an Affiliated Asynchronous Error
for any associated Work Queues when they attempt to use that
CQ. Completions can no longer be added to the CQ. It is not guaranteed
that completions present in the CQ at the time the error occurred can be
retrieved. Possible causes include a CQ overrun or a CQ protection error.

Put the qp in error state when cq is full. Implement a state called full
to continue to put other associated QPs in error state.

# f6f3f532 18-Mar-2019 Kaike Wan <kaike.wan@intel.com>

IB/hfi1: Delay the release of destination mr for TID RDMA WRITE DATA

The reference of destination memory region is first obtained when TID RDMA
WRITE request is first received on the responder side. This reference is
released once all TID RDMA WRITE RESP packets are sent to the requester
side, even though not all TID RDMA WRITE DATA packets may have been
received. This early release will especially be undesired if the software
needs to access the destination memory before the last data packet is
received.

This patch delays the release of the MR until all TID RDMA DATA packets
have been received. A helper function to release the reference is also
created to simplify the code.

# 34025fb0 23-Jan-2019 Kaike Wan <kaike.wan@intel.com>

IB/hfi1: Prioritize the sending of ACK packets

ACK packets are generally associated with request completion and resource
release and therefore should be sent first. This patch optimizes the
send engine by using the following policies:
(1) QPs with RVT_S_ACK_PENDING bit set in qp->s_flags or qpriv->s_flags
should have their priority incremented;
(2) QPs with ACK or TID-ACK packet queued should have their priority
incremented;
(3) When a QP is queued to the wait list due to resource constraints, it
will be queued to the head if it has ACK packet to send;
(4) When selecting qps to run from the wait list, the one with the highest
priority and starve_cnt will be selected; each priority will be equivalent
to a fixed number of starve_cnt (16).

# 4f9264d1 23-Jan-2019 Kaike Wan <kaike.wan@intel.com>

IB/hfi1: Add an s_acked_ack_queue pointer

The s_ack_queue is managed by two pointers into the ring:
r_head_ack_queue and s_tail_ack_queue. r_head_ack_queue is the index of
where the next received request is going to be placed and s_tail_ack_queue
is the entry of the request currently being processed. This works
perfectly fine for normal Verbs as the requests are processed one at a
time and the s_tail_ack_queue is not moved until the request that it
points to is fully completed.

In this fashion, s_tail_ack_queue constantly chases r_head_ack_queue and
the two pointers can easily be used to determine "queue full" and "queue
empty" conditions.

The detection of these two conditions are imported in determining when an
old entry can safely be overwritten with a new received request and the
resources associated with the old request be safely released.

When pipelined TID RDMA WRITE is introduced into this mix, things look
very different. r_head_ack_queue is still the point at which a newly
received request will be inserted, s_tail_ack_queue is still the
currently processed request. However, with pipelined TID RDMA WRITE
requests, s_tail_ack_queue moves to the next request once all TID RDMA
WRITE responses for that request have been sent. The rest of the protocol
for a particular request is managed by other pointers specific to TID RDMA
- r_tid_tail and r_tid_ack - which point to the entries for which the next
TID RDMA DATA packets are going to arrive and the request for which
the next TID RDMA ACK packets are to be generated, respectively.

What this means is that entries in the ring, which are "behind"
s_tail_ack_queue (entries which s_tail_ack_queue has gone past) are no
longer considered complete. This is where the problem is - a newly
received request could potentially overwrite a still active TID RDMA WRITE
request.

The reason why the TID RDMA pointers trail s_tail_ack_queue is that the
normal Verbs send engine uses s_tail_ack_queue as the pointer for the next
response. Since TID RDMA WRITE responses are processed by the normal Verbs
send engine, s_tail_ack_queue had to be moved to the next entry once all
TID RDMA WRITE response packets were sent to get the desired pipelining
between requests. Doing otherwise would mean that the normal Verbs send
engine would not be able to send the TID RDMA WRITE responses for the next
TID RDMA request until the current one is fully completed.

This patch introduces the s_acked_ack_queue index to point to the next
request to complete on the responder side. For requests other than TID
RDMA WRITE, s_acked_ack_queue should always be kept in sync with
s_tail_ack_queue. For TID RDMA WRITE request, it may fall behind
s_tail_ack_queue.

# 48a615dc 23-Jan-2019 Kaike Wan <kaike.wan@intel.com>

IB/hfi1: Integrate OPFN into RC transactions

OPFN parameter negotiation allows a pair of connected RC QPs to exchange
a set of parameters in succession. This negotiation does not commence
till the first ULP request. Because OPFN operations are operations
private to the driver, they do not generate user completions or put the
QP into error when they run out of retries. This patch integrates the
OPFN protocol into the transactions of an RC QP.

# 44e43d91 24-Jan-2019 Mitko Haralanov <mitko.haralanov@intel.com>

IB/hfi1: OPFN support discovery

OPFN (Omni Path Feature Negotiation) support discovery allows a RC QP to
announce that it supports OPFN and also discover if OPFN is supported by
the peer QP. OPFN parameter negotiation is skipped unless OPFN support is
first discovered. OPFN support is announced by claiming what was
the reserved bit in dword 1 of OmniPath modified base transport header
in requests and responses.

# 5b0ef650 21-Aug-2017 Mike Marciniszyn <mike.marciniszyn@intel.com>

IB/{qib, hfi1}: Avoid flow control testing for RDMA write operation

Section 9.7.7.2.5 of the 1.3 IBTA spec clearly says that receive
credits should never apply to RDMA write.

qib and hfi1 were doing that. The following situation will result
in a QP hang:
- A prior SEND or RDMA_WRITE with immmediate consumed the last
credit for a QP using RC receive buffer credits
- The prior op is acked so there are no more acks
- The peer ULP fails to post receive for some reason
- An RDMA write sees that the credits are exhausted and waits
- The peer ULP posts receive buffers
- The ULP posts a send or RDMA write that will be hung

The fix is to avoid the credit test for the RDMA write operation.

# b777f154 07-Dec-2016 Mitko Haralanov <mitko.haralanov@intel.com>

IB/hfi1: Remove usage of qp->s_cur_sge

The s_cur_sge field in the qp structure holds a pointer to the
SGE of the currently processed WQE. It assumes the protection
of the RVT_S_BUSY flag to prevent the changing of this field
while the send engine is using it. This scheme works as long
as there is only one instance of the send engine running at a
time.

Scaling of the send engine to multiple cores would break this
assumption as there could be multiple instances of the send engine
running on different CPUs. This opens a window where the QP's
RVT_S_BUSY flag is not set but the send engine is still running.

To prevent accidental changing of the s_cur_sge pointer, the QP's
dependence on it is removed. The SGE pointer is now stored in the
verbs_txreq, which is a per-packet data structure. This ensures
that each individual packet has it's own pointer, which is setup
while the RVT_S_BUSY flag is set.

# 72f53af2 25-Sep-2016 Mike Marciniszyn <mike.marciniszyn@intel.com>

IB/hfi1: Fix defered ack race with qp destroy

There is a a bug in defered ack stuff that causes a race with the
destroy of a QP.

A packet causes a defered ack to be pended by putting the QP
into an rcd queue.

A return from the driver interrupt processing will process that rcd
queue of QPs and attempt to do a direct send of the ack. At this
point no locks are held and the above QP could now be put in the reset
state in the qp destroy logic. A refcount protects the QP while it
is in the rcd queue so it isn't going anywhere yet.

If the direct send fails to allocate a pio buffer,
hfi1_schedule_send() is called to trigger sending an ack from the
send engine. There is no state test in that code path.

The refcount is then dropped from the driver.c caller
potentially allowing the qp destroy to continue from its
refcount wait in parallel with the workqueue scheduling of the qp.

# d9b13c20 25-Jul-2016 Jianxin Xiong <jianxin.xiong@intel.com>

IB/rdmavt, hfi1: Fix NFSoRDMA failure with FRMR enabled

Hanging has been observed while writing a file over NFSoRDMA. Dmesg on
the server contains messages like these:

[ 931.992501] svcrdma: Error -22 posting RDMA_READ
[ 952.076879] svcrdma: Error -22 posting RDMA_READ
[ 982.154127] svcrdma: Error -22 posting RDMA_READ
[ 1012.235884] svcrdma: Error -22 posting RDMA_READ
[ 1042.319194] svcrdma: Error -22 posting RDMA_READ

Here is why:

With the base memory management extension enabled, FRMR is used instead
of FMR. The xprtrdma server issues each RDMA read request as the following
bundle:

(1)IB_WR_REG_MR, signaled;
(2)IB_WR_RDMA_READ, signaled;
(3)IB_WR_LOCAL_INV, signaled & fencing.

These requests are signaled. In order to generate completion, the fast
register work request is processed by the hfi1 send engine after being
posted to the work queue, and the corresponding lkey is not valid until
the request is processed. However, the rdmavt driver validates lkey when
the RDMA read request is posted and thus it fails immediately with error
-EINVAL (-22).

This patch changes the work flow of local operations (fast register and
local invalidate) so that fast register work requests are always
processed immediately to ensure that the corresponding lkey is valid
when subsequent work requests are posted. Local invalidate requests are
processed immediately if fencing is not required and no previous local
invalidate request is pending.

To allow completion generation for signaled local operations that have
been processed before posting to the work queue, an internal send flag
RVT_SEND_COMPLETION_ONLY is added. The hfi1 send engine checks this flag
and only generates completion for such requests.
